What is Foreclosure Defense?

Foreclosure defense encompasses legal strategies homeowners use to challenge or halt foreclosure proceedings in California. Common defenses include lender violations of lending laws, failure to follow proper procedures, fraudulent loan origination, and breach of contract. California law provides several protections, including requirements for lenders to attempt loan modifications before foreclosure. Homeowners can file hardship applications, request temporary stays, or challenge the validity of the debt itself. Foreclosure defense may also involve negotiating short sales or loan restructuring agreements. An experienced attorney can identify which defenses apply to your situation, ensuring your rights are protected throughout the legal process.

💰 How much does it cost?

Foreclosure defense attorney costs typically start at $3,000 and can range significantly higher depending on case complexity. Some attorneys charge hourly rates ($150-$400+), while others work on flat fees for specific services. Initial consultations are often free or low-cost. Costs vary based on whether you pursue judicial or non-judicial foreclosure defenses.

Frequently Asked Questions

Q: How long does foreclosure defense take in Contra Costa County?

A: Foreclosure timelines vary, but judicial foreclosure typically takes 6-18 months in Contra Costa County. Non-judicial foreclosures move faster, usually 4-6 months. Effective foreclosure defense can extend this timeline by filing objections, motions, and legal challenges. Delays depend on case complexity and court schedules.

Q: Do I need an attorney for foreclosure defense in Pittsburg?

A: While self-representation is possible, an experienced foreclosure defense attorney significantly improves your chances of success. Attorneys understand California foreclosure laws, local Pittsburg court procedures, and valid legal defenses. They identify procedural errors lenders commonly make. Professional representation is strongly recommended to protect your rights and home.

Q: What documents do I need for foreclosure defense?

A: Essential documents include your original loan documents, promissory note, deed of trust, payment history, default notices, foreclosure complaint, and any correspondence with your lender. Gather loan modification requests, hardship applications, and communications about payment arrangements. These documents help identify lender violations or procedural errors that strengthen your defense.

Q: What happens if I wait too long to pursue foreclosure defense?

A: Delaying foreclosure defense reduces your options significantly. Once a trustee sale occurs, your home ownership ends and recovery becomes nearly impossible. Acting immediately upon receiving a notice of default or foreclosure notice is critical. California law provides specific timeframes for filing defenses, so prompt legal action protects your interests.
